feat: Phase 4 V1 — Robustness Hardening Adds the observability + safety layer that turns AtoCore from "works until something silently breaks" into "every mutation is traceable, drift is detected, failures raise alerts." 1. Audit log (memory_audit table): - New table with id, memory_id, action, actor, before/after JSON, note, timestamp; 3 indexes for memory_id/timestamp/action - _audit_memory() helper called from every mutation: create_memory, update_memory, promote_memory, reject_candidate_memory, invalidate_memory, supersede_memory, reinforce_memory, auto_promote_reinforced, expire_stale_candidates - Action verb auto-selected: promoted/rejected/invalidated/ superseded/updated based on state transition - "actor" threaded through: api-http, human-triage, phase10-auto- promote, candidate-expiry, reinforcement, etc. - Fail-open: audit write failure logs but never breaks the mutation - GET /memory/{id}/audit: full history for one memory - GET /admin/audit/recent: last 50 mutations across the system 2. Alerts framework (src/atocore/observability/alerts.py): - emit_alert(severity, title, message, context) fans out to: - structlog logger (always) - ~/atocore-logs/alerts.log append (configurable via ATOCORE_ALERT_LOG) - project_state atocore/alert/last_{severity} (dashboard surface) - ATOCORE_ALERT_WEBHOOK POST if set (auto-detects Discord webhook format for nice embeds; generic JSON otherwise) - Every sink fail-open — one failure doesn't prevent the others - Pipeline alert step in nightly cron: harness < 85% → warning; candidate queue > 200 → warning 3. Integrity checks (scripts/integrity_check.py): - Nightly scan for drift: - Memories → missing source_chunk_id references - Duplicate active memories (same type+content+project) - project_state → missing projects - Orphaned source_chunks (no parent document) - Results persisted to atocore/status/integrity_check_result - Any finding emits a warning alert - Added as Step G in deploy/dalidou/batch-extract.sh nightly cron 4. Dashboard surfaces it all: - integrity (findings + details) - alerts (last info/warning/critical per severity) - recent_audit (last 10 mutations with actor + action + preview) Tests: 308 → 317 (9 new): - test_audit_create_logs_entry - test_audit_promote_logs_entry - test_audit_reject_logs_entry - test_audit_update_captures_before_after - test_audit_reinforce_logs_entry - test_recent_audit_returns_cross_memory_entries - test_emit_alert_writes_log_file - test_emit_alert_invalid_severity_falls_back_to_info - test_emit_alert_fails_open_on_log_write_error Deferred: formal migration framework with rollback (current additive pattern is fine for V1); memory detail wiki page with audit view (quick follow-up). To enable Discord alerts: set ATOCORE_ALERT_WEBHOOK to a Discord webhook URL in Dalidou's environment. Default = log-only.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>

"""Tests for the Phase 4 alerts framework."""
from __future__ import annotations
import os
import tempfile
from pathlib import Path
import pytest
import atocore.config as _config
@p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
def isolated_env(monkeypatch):
"""Isolate alerts sinks per test."""
tmpdir = tempfile.mkdtemp()
log_file = Path(tmpdir) / "alerts.log"
monkeypatch.setenv("ATOCORE_ALERT_LOG", str(log_file))
monkeypatch.delenv("ATOCORE_ALERT_WEBHOOK", raising=False)
# Data dir for any state writes
monkeypatch.setenv("ATOCORE_DATA_DIR", tmpdir)
_config.settings = _config.Settings()
from atocore.models.database import init_db
init_db()
yield {"tmpdir": tmpdir, "log_file": log_file}
def test_emit_alert_writes_log_file(isolated_env):
from atocore.observability.alerts import emit_alert
emit_alert("warning", "test title", "test message body", context={"count": 5})
content = isolated_env["log_file"].read_text(encoding="utf-8")
assert "test title" in content
assert "test message body" in content
assert "WARNING" in content
assert '"count": 5' in content
def test_emit_alert_invalid_severity_falls_back_to_info(isolated_env):
from atocore.observability.alerts import emit_alert
emit_alert("made-up-severity", "t", "m")
content = isolated_env["log_file"].read_text(encoding="utf-8")
assert "INFO" in content
def test_emit_alert_fails_open_on_log_write_error(monkeypatch, isolated_env):
"""An unwritable log path should not crash the emit."""
from atocore.observability.alerts import emit_alert
monkeypatch.setenv("ATOCORE_ALERT_LOG", "/nonexistent/path/that/definitely/is/not/writable/alerts.log")
# Must not raise
emit_alert("info", "t", "m")
